Bitcoin & Altcoin Volatility to Spike Ahead of the Final Trading Week

2025/12/15 18:50
  • Global markets face heavy economic data releases as year-end liquidity thins rapidly.
  • US jobs and retail sales on Tuesday may quickly shift market sentiment.
  • UK and US inflation data midweek could drive short-term crypto price direction.

The final full trading week before the holiday break is packed with major economic events that could trigger sharp moves across global markets, including crypto, equities, and currencies. 

With major economic data, multiple central bank decisions, and thinning year-end liquidity, investors are about to get a last, powerful reality check on growth, inflation, and monetary policy. One surprise print could be enough to flip sentiment fast.

Global Data Hits as Holiday Liquidity Thins

The week opens with fresh economic signals from Europe, and the United States:

Tuesday Could Set the Tone for the Week

Tuesday is expected to be one of the most active trading days. The US releases its delayed November jobs report, covering Nonfarm Payrolls and the unemployment rate. This data matters because the Federal Reserve has recently linked its policy outlook to changes in the labor market.

US retail sales figures are also due, showing whether consumer spending remains resilient heading into the holiday season.

At the same time, PMI data from Europe and the UK adds to the potential for increased volatility across crypto, equities, and currencies.

Inflation Takes Center Stage Midweek

Inflation data will shape market expectations as the week progresses. On Wednesday, the UK publishes CPI inflation figures ahead of the Bank of England’s rate decision. Any surprise could shift views on future policy direction.

Thursday brings the US CPI report, one of the most closely watched inflation updates of the month. For crypto markets, this release often sets the short-term trend.

Central Bank Decisions Come Into Focus

The second half of the week is dominated by interest rate decisions. The European Central Bank, Bank of England, Riksbank, and Norges Bank will all announce policy updates. Even small changes in language can influence market direction.

Friday’s spotlight is on the Bank of Japan. Markets are watching closely amid expectations of a rate hike. The last time the BOJ raised rates in July 2024, Bitcoin fell nearly 23%.

Why Crypto Traders Are on Edge

Crypto markets are already flashing warning signals. Bitcoin, Ethereum, XRP and Solana among other altcoins are showing signs of increased price swings, with Bitcoin hovering near important technical levels. Ethereum has held up relatively well, but sentiment could change quickly depending on incoming data.

As the holiday break approaches, thinner liquidity may amplify market moves.

Bitcoin ETFs Revive with $241 Million Inflow, Ethereum ETFs Report Lowest Trading Value of the Week

Bitcoin ETFs Revive with $241 Million Inflow, Ethereum ETFs Report Lowest Trading Value of the Week

The post Bitcoin ETFs Revive with $241 Million Inflow, Ethereum ETFs Report Lowest Trading Value of the Week appeared first on Coinpedia Fintech News On September 24, the US spot Bitcoin ETF saw a combined inflow of $241.00 million, while Ethereum ETFs continued their day 3 streak of outflow. It recorded a total net outflow of $79.36 million, as per the SoSoValue report.  Bitcoin ETF Breakdown  After two consecutive days of experiencing huge sell-offs, Bitcoin ETFs finally managed to record an inflow of $241.00 million. BlackRock IBIT led with $128.90 million, and Ark and 21Shares ARKB followed with $37.72 million.  Additional gains were made by Fidelity FBTC, Bitwise BITB, and Grayscale BTC of $29.70 million, $24.69 million, and $13.56 million, respectively. VanEck HODL also made a smaller addition of $6.42 million in inflows.  Despite the inflows, the total trading value of the Bitcoin ETF dropped to $2.58 billion, with total net assets $149.74 billion. This marks 6.62% of Bitcoin market cap, slightly higher than the previous day.  Ethereum ETF Breakdown  Ethereum ETFs saw a total outflow of $79.36 million, with Fidelity’s FETH leading with $33.26 million. BlackRock ETHA also experienced heavy selling pressure of $26.47 million, followed by Grayscale’s ETHE $8.91 million. 21Shares TETH and Bitwise ETHW also posted smaller withdrawals of $6.24 million and $4.48 million, respectively.  The total trading value of Ethereum ETFs dropped below a billion, reaching $971.79 million. Net assets came in at $27.42 billion, representing 5.45% of the Ethereum market cap.  Ethereum ETF Market Context  Bitcoin is trading at $111,766, signalling a 4.6% drop compared to a week ago. Its market cap has also dipped to $2.225 trillion. Its daily trading volume has reached $49.837 billion, showing mild progress there.  Ethereum is priced at $4,011.92, with a market cap of $483.822 billion, showing a sharp decline. Its trading volume has also slipped to $37.680 billion, reflecting a slow market.  Due to heavy outflow this week, Bitcoin and Ethereum’s prices are experiencing price swings. Crypto analysts from Bloomberg warn the market to brace for further volatility.
